MySQLはクロスプラットフォーム対応?対応OSと注意点を解説

MySQL

データベース管理システムとして広く利用されているMySQLは、異なるOS環境でも利用できるかどうかは重要なポイントです。本記事では、MySQLのクロスプラットフォーム対応状況と、環境ごとの利用方法を解説します。

MySQLのクロスプラットフォーム対応とは

MySQLは、Windows、macOS、Linuxなど複数のOSに対応しており、同じデータベースソフトを異なるOS上で利用することができます。これはクロスプラットフォーム対応と呼ばれ、開発環境や運用環境を選ばずに使用できるメリットがあります。

各OSでのインストール方法

各OS向けにMySQLは公式サイトからバイナリパッケージやインストーラーが提供されています。例えば。

  • Windows:MySQL Installerを使用してGUIで簡単にセットアップ可能
  • macOS:Homebrewや公式dmgパッケージでインストール
  • Linux:aptやyumなどのパッケージ管理ツールを使用

このようにOSごとの手順に沿ってインストールすることで、同じMySQL環境を複数のプラットフォームで構築できます。

クロスプラットフォームでの注意点

クロスプラットフォーム対応とはいえ、いくつか注意点があります。

  • データベースファイルの直接コピーはOS間で互換性がない場合がある
  • 文字コードや改行コードの違いに注意する
  • OS固有のファイルパスや権限設定が必要になる場合がある

データ移行やバックアップ時は、mysqldumpなどの標準ツールを使うことで安全に移行できます。

まとめ

MySQLはWindows、macOS、Linuxなど複数のOSで利用可能なクロスプラットフォーム対応のデータベースです。OSごとにインストール方法や設定に注意すれば、異なる環境でも同じMySQLを使用できます。ただし、データの移行やファイル互換性には注意が必要です。

コメント

タイトルとURLをコピーしました